The GE IC200MDL750C VersaMax Discrete Output Module is used for switching discrete field devices from a VersaMax control system. It handles binary output commands from the controller and transfers those commands to connected actuators, relays, solenoids, contactors, indicators, and other on/off devices.
In a typical machine-control application, the module sits between the VersaMax CPU or network interface and the field wiring. Output commands generated by the control program are processed by the I/O system and delivered through the module to the corresponding field circuits. This arrangement allows individual machine functions to be controlled from the PLC program without adding separate output hardware for each control point.
The IC200MDL750C is particularly suitable for distributed discrete control where multiple switching functions are located around a machine or production line. It can be installed as part of a VersaMax I/O station and used alongside other discrete and analog modules to build a mixed I/O configuration.
For maintenance and replacement work, the module is also useful when restoring an existing VersaMax installation. Keeping the same module family and compatible configuration helps reduce changes to the existing PLC program, field wiring, and I/O architecture.

The IC200MDL750C receives discrete output commands from the VersaMax control system and converts the controller’s logical output states into corresponding field-side switching actions.
VersaMax CPU / Network Interface → IC200MDL750C → Discrete Field Circuit → Actuator or Indication Device
When the control program changes an output state, the I/O system transfers the corresponding command to the module. The module processes the output state and controls the associated field circuit. The connected device can then respond by switching, energizing, de-energizing, starting, stopping, opening, closing, or indicating a machine condition.

The GE IC200MDL750C functions as an output interface within the VersaMax I/O architecture. It takes output information generated by the controller and routes the appropriate discrete commands toward field equipment.
PLC Control Logic → VersaMax I/O Network → IC200MDL750C → Field Wiring → Discrete Device
| System Element | Function |
|---|---|
| PLC / VersaMax Controller | Executes the automation program and determines output states |
| I/O Network / Interface | Transfers control information between the controller and I/O station |
| IC200MDL750C | Processes discrete output commands for field devices |
| Terminal / Field Wiring | Connects module outputs with external circuits |
| Relays / Contactors | Switch higher-level machine circuits where required |
| Solenoids / Actuators | Perform physical machine operations |
| Indicators / Alarms | Provide visual or status indication |
This arrangement allows output functions to remain modular and makes it easier to isolate field-level problems during commissioning and maintenance.

For existing installations, maintenance should also include checking the condition of the terminal assemblies, field wiring, connected loads, and neighboring I/O modules. A structured point-by-point test helps prevent an output module replacement from masking a wiring or field-device problem.

Start by checking the PLC logic and commanded output state, then verify I/O communication, module status, field wiring, terminal connections, and the connected device. This sequence helps determine whether the problem is in the control program, I/O hardware, wiring, or field equipment.
